C3 Protein (Complement Component 3)

Overview

C3 Protein (Complement Component 3) is a central hub of the [complement system](/entities/complement-system) and plays a critical role in innate immunity and neuroinflammation. It is one of the most abundant proteins in the complement system and serves as a convergence point for all three complement activation pathways. In the central nervous system, C3 is produced by [neurons](/cell-types/neurons), [astrocytes](/cell-types/astrocytes), [microglia](/cell-types/microglia-neuroinflammation), and [oligodendrocytes](/cell-types/oligodendrocyte-lineage-ad), making it a key mediator of neuroinflammatory processes in neurodegenerative diseases.
